Questões de Concurso Público IF Baiano 2017 para Analista de Tecnologia da Informação

Foram encontradas 4 questões

Q831563 Banco de Dados

O modelo de dados entidade-relacionamento (E-R) foi desenvolvido para facilitar o projeto de banco de dados. Esse modelo emprega algumas noções básicas, tais como conjuntos de entidades e de relacionamentos, além das respectivas características.

Associe as colunas, relacionando os elementos de E-R às suas características / definições.


Elementos

1. Atributo de um conjunto de entidades

2. Participação

3. Papel da entidade

4. Relacionamento

5. Cardinalidades de mapeamento


Características / definições

( ) Função desempenhada por uma entidade em um relacionamento.

( ) Associação entre várias entidades.

( ) Função que descreve conjuntos de relacionamento binários.

( ) Associação entre conjuntos de entidades.

( ) Função que mapeia do conjunto de entidades para um domínio.


A sequência correta dessa associação é

Alternativas
Q831564 Banco de Dados

Com base na seguinte expressão algébrica relacional:


Π numf (Funcionarios) ∩ Π numf (Dependentes)


a expressão SQL correspondente é

Alternativas
Q831581 Banco de Dados

Restrições de integridade impedem que dados inválidos sejam inseridos nas tabelas, assim como garantem que não haverá relacionamento referenciando uma chave primária inexistente.


A restrição de integridade, que assegura exclusividade no valor de uma tupla formada por uma ou mais colunas, sendo possível, inclusive, inserir mais de uma restrição desse tipo em uma mesma tabela, é conhecida como

Alternativas
Q831582 Banco de Dados

Analise as afirmações abaixo com relação ao processamento de transações em Sistemas de Gerenciamento de Bancos de Dados (SGBD) e assinale (V) para verdadeiro ou (F) para falso.


( ) A serialização da execução concorrente da transação pode ser usada para definir as sequências de execução corretas de transações simultâneas.

( ) As operações básicas de acesso ao banco de dados executadas por parte de uma transação são read e write.

( ) O modo de especificar a conclusão de uma transação é determinado apenas pela instrução de confirmação da transação (commit).

( ) A propriedade ISOLAMENTO indica que uma transação deve ser executada de forma independente das demais, de modo que ao ser completamente executada, sem interferências de outras transações, deve levar o banco de dados de um estado consistente para outro.

( ) A propriedade ATOMICIDADE estabelece que uma transação deve ser executada em sua totalidade ou não ser realizada de forma alguma, de modo que se exige que esta transação seja executada até o fim.


De acordo com as afirmações, a sequência correta é

Alternativas
Respostas
1: E
2: D
3: C
4: A